Students focus on finances

Teenagers at a North Warwickshire school are being given the opportunity to discover the importance of efficient personal money handling.

The 14 year olds at Kingsbury School will enjoy a day of help and guidance on Thursday, July 9.

The Warwickshire Education Business Partnership, a part of Warwickshire County Council, will be delivering a session totally devoted to the many financial issues and choices which face young people today.

They will look at personal spending and budgeting, the cost of living, sales ploys, credit, etc. A number of business people will act as consultants for the students from businesses such as Coventry Building Society, Warwickshire County Council and Jaguar Land Rover.

This event is organised by the Warwickshire Education Business Partnership as their commitment towards helping students of all ages become better prepared for the world of work.
